The Industrial Revolution was started in the year of 1760. During Industrial Revolution the production of goods were transited from small shops and homes to large factories. This led people to move from rural areas to big cities in order to work.
After Industrial Revolution, "Worker Safety Laws" were passed to ensure the working environment is safety for workers. Power provided by steam engines was the power commonly harnessed during the later phases of the industrial revolution.
